Given:
Principal = 15,000
interest = 8.5%
term = 9 years
I = 15,000 * 8.5% * 9 years = 11,475
total amount after 9 years = 15,000 + 11,475 = 26, 475
Preterm after 2 years. wdl of 4,000. penalty is 6 months interest of 4,000
I = 4,000 * 8.5% * 6/12 = 170 amount of penalty
I = 15,000 * 8.5% * 2 years = 2,550 interest earned for 2 years
15,000 + 2,550 = 17,550
17,550 - 4,000 - 170 = 13,380 amount to be invested for another 7 years
I = 13,380 * 8.5% * 7 years = 7,961.10
total amount after 9 years with pretermination
13,380 + 7,961.10 = 21,341.10
